Forum: Mikrocontroller und Digitale Elektronik Probleme mit Ansteuerung SD Karte


von Samuel (Gast)


Angehängte Dateien:

Lesenswert?

Hi zusammen,

ich habe hier schon einige Beiträge zu dem Thema gelesen mit der 
gleichen Problemstellung, aber ich habe damit das Problem trotzdem nicht 
gefunden.

folgende Facts:
- Schaltplan im Anhang
- ich nutze die Bibliothek von Ulrich Radig
- Software SPI (bitte keine Diskussion warum nicht Hardware SPI)
- Ausschnitt aus mmc.h:
#define SPI_Mode            0
#define MMC_Write           PORTD
#define MMC_Read            PIND
#define MMC_Directioon_REG  DDRD

#define SPI_DI              7
#define SPI_DO              6
#define SPI_Clock           5
#define SPI_Chip_Select     4
#define SPI_SS              0

- mmc_init() liefert immer 1 als Rückgabewert. Die Antwort der MMC Karte 
klappt also nicht (oder schon vorher was nicht...)
- zuerst hatte ich die Steuerleitungen per Spannungsteiler ausgeführt, 
das habe ich jetzt (wie im Schaltplan zu sehen) auf einen HC4050 
umgestellt.
- Kabellängen sind max ca. 5 cm (Lackdraht, ist das problematisch?)
- ich habe zwei SD Karten getestet: 2Gb Transcend und 512 MB Dane-Elec

Habt ihr noch Ideen?

Sammy

von Benedikt K. (benedikt)


Lesenswert?

Pullup an DO?

von Samuel (Gast)


Lesenswert?

bisher nicht.
Pullup am DO gegen 3,3V oder?

lg
Sammy

von Benedikt K. (benedikt)


Lesenswert?

Ja.

von Samuel (Gast)


Lesenswert?

leider trotzdem keine Besserung :-(

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.